Milk processors creaming off dairy profits

Wholesale cream prices are on the increase thanks to good demand and low supplies.

But the news has left dairy farmers scratching their heads wondering why their milk price is not enjoying the same up turn in fortune.

Milk processors have been quick to blame recent price cuts on low cream prices but as the tide is turning extra profits are not being passed back to farmers.

NFU dairy board vice chairman Mansel Raymond said: "With confidence in the dairy industry at an all time low farmers could do with a welcome boost in the market place.

"However while this price rise is good news, most of the extra profit afforded from cream will line processors' pockets – they are literally creaming off the extra cash.


"The NFU remains committed to calling for supermarkets and processors to share some of their profits back down the supply chain, so farmers can benefit from this price uplift and go some way to avoiding a meltdown in the dairy industry."
